How they compare

Jordan currently reports 49,102 current US$ per square kilometre against 48,680 current US$ per square kilometre in Malta, a difference of 422 current US$ per square kilometre.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 52 shared years of data; in 1972 it was Malta ahead.

Jordan ranks 58th and Malta ranks 59th of 194 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Jordan averaged higher in 1 and Malta in 5.

Head to head by decade

Decade Jordan Malta Difference Ahead
1970s 3,271 current US$ per square kilometre 78,714 current US$ per square kilometre 75,443 current US$ per square kilometre Malta
1980s 11,244 current US$ per square kilometre 134,514 current US$ per square kilometre 123,270 current US$ per square kilometre Malta
1990s 13,118 current US$ per square kilometre 78,243 current US$ per square kilometre 65,125 current US$ per square kilometre Malta
2000s 29,437 current US$ per square kilometre 494,117 current US$ per square kilometre 464,680 current US$ per square kilometre Malta
2010s 51,879 current US$ per square kilometre 543,559 current US$ per square kilometre 491,680 current US$ per square kilometre Malta
2020s 53,560 current US$ per square kilometre 43,446 current US$ per square kilometre 10,114 current US$ per square kilometre Jordan

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
